PRESENTATION OF THE TURKISH TRANSLATION OF ABDULLA ARIPOV’S POEMS
On March 11, 2026, a presentation of the Turkish translation of the poetry collection “BEN NİÇİN SEVERİM ÖZBEKİSTAN’I” and a roundtable discussion dedicated to the 85th anniversary of the birth of the Hero of Uzbekistan and People’s Poet Abdulla Aripov was held at Tashkent State University of Oriental Studies.
The event was opened by the Rector of the university, Professor Gulchekhra Rikhsiyeva. During the roundtable, the First Vice-Rector for Youth Affairs and Spiritual-Educational Work Kudratulla Omonov, poet Khanifa Mustafayeva, as well as Shoira Aripova and Rukhsora Aripova delivered speeches. They shared their views on the poet’s life, his rich creative heritage, and the contemporary study of his works.
During the event, students recited selected poems by the poet and presented a comparative reading of the original texts and their translations.
The compiler and translator of the book Khayrulla Khamidov and Doctor of Philology, Associate Professor Rustam Sharipov also participated with their presentations.
At the end of the roundtable, a Q&A session was held, during which participants exchanged views on the life and creative work of Abdulla Aripov, the essence of his poetry, and issues related to translating his works into foreign languages. The event emphasized the poet’s rich literary legacy and his significant contribution to the development of national literature.
